Transaction 73e1fe0246f70e32ac7ebc1545ba051610397529125002e31e78efa323eefb23

1 Input
2 Outputs
  • 73e1fe0246f70e32ac7ebc1545ba051610397529125002e31e78efa323eefb23:0
  • value  723780858
    address  3QDSMo6SGP5e4wXex6kSGdNwu5RBL1j47w
  • 73e1fe0246f70e32ac7ebc1545ba051610397529125002e31e78efa323eefb23:1
  • value  57120
    address  14JmiHcKNgc1s2Xn5oHU5bwe9mLyC6bpjr